About me 

I  am an Australian trained clinical psychologist and a licenced clinical psychologist in Austria. My  training includes c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T), schema therapy, mindfulness, E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ing), and acceptance and commitment therapy.

 

I was born in Reykjavík, Iceland. I studied psychology at the University of Iceland and earned my Postgraduate and Master of Applied Psychology with specialisation in clinical psychology at Murdoch University in Perth, Australia. During my studies I specialised in assessment and therapy for both adults and children.

I lived in Perth, Australia for four years studying and working as a clinical psychologist in different hospital settings. In Australia, I  specialized in trauma, anxiety, depression (including postnatal depression), grief and loss, personality disorders, self esteem, personal growth, positive parenting, attachment issues and early intervention.

I have  now been living in Austria for around 16 years with my Austrian husband and three sons.

I was managing and supervising  the student Counseling Center at Webster Vienna Private University for 10 years before going into full time private practice.

With my practice work, I teach psychology courses at Webster Vienna University and IES abroad.

I am  accredited as a clinical psychologist in Austria (Eintragungsnummer: 12794) and  registered with the BÖP (Berufsverband Österreichischer PsychologInnen).
